Mastercard Foundation/Arizona State University Scholarship 2025

The Mastercard Foundation Scholars Program at Arizona State University (ASU) offers 160 graduate scholarships from 2025 to 2030.

This programme provides online degrees with in-person support from Kepler College in Rwanda.

Available Graduate Degree Programmes

For fall 2025, 40 scholars will be selected for the following online master’s programmes:

College of Global Futures

  • MS Global Technology and Development

W.P. Carey School of Business

  • MS Business Analytics

Mary Lou Fulton College for Teaching and Learning Innovation

  • MEd Learning Design and Technologies

Ira A. Fulton Schools of Engineering

  • MS Information Technology
  • MSE Sustainable Engineering

Scholarship Benefits

  • Full tuition coverage for the two-year programme.
  • On-campus accommodation during the required in-person sessions.
  • Individual mentorship and leadership development.
  • Participation in a two-month summer intensive at ASU in the United States between the first and second year.

Who Can Apply

To qualify, candidates must:

  • Meet academic and English language requirements.
  • Be an African citizen committed to ethical leadership and community engagement.
  • Be between 18 and 33 years old.
  • Have completed an undergraduate degree by July 2025.
  • Have no prior graduate degree started or completed before August 2025.
  • Reside in Kigali, Rwanda for the programme duration.
